Comic-Con: Be the First to See the “Mockingjay” Trailer

Screen Shot 2014-07-18 at 3.05.27 PMThough the marketing for the upcoming The Hunger Games: Mockingjay, Part 1 so far has been AWESOME, fans are anxiously waiting for the actual trailer to arrive. Now we finally have word about how and when fans can get their first look at the much anticipated trailer.

According to an article from MTV, Lionsgate has paired up with Samsung in a partnership to grant San Diego Comic-Con attendees a sneak peek at the trailer on Friday, July 25 at 12pm Pacific, but it’ll only be viewed on the Samsung Galaxy Tab S. “All fans need to do is make their way to the Samsung Galaxy Experience Capitol Gallery, where select cast members from ‘The Hunger Games: Mockingjay – Part 1’ will be on hand to introduce the trailer,” according to the article.

No news yet on which cast members will be present, though I’m sure fans are hoping for a big surprise especially with the news that there will be no Lionsgate panel for the film at San Diego this year.

If you’re not in San Diego this year, you can apparently still check out the trailer on Saturday, July 26 “at Samsung Experience Shops inside select Best Buy locations. The exclusive preview will be available from July 26-27, with visitors also getting a complimentary pass to see ‘The Hunger Games: Mockingjay – Part 1’ in theaters November 2,” the article continues. Sounds like a cool enough, if not convoluted, deal.  Though non-Android users beware: the article claims that a special movie pack app for the film will only be available for select Galaxy device owners, starting July 28.
